Output 66b3333bd3539557988f8d5c006b0b5d54e15138cdd672357504a78917496426:1

value
794102
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de6be444d47d14275bca01defcf7ae26d1363194 OP_EQUALVERIFY OP_CHECKSIG
address
1MH4G2pY3RY72LJD9nf5JdX9pTnYU4ZaKC
transaction
66b3333bd3539557988f8d5c006b0b5d54e15138cdd672357504a78917496426
confirmations
164059
spent
true